SQL SERVER 子查询使用Order By;按In排序 【子查询】使用order by select*from(selecttop100percent*fromtableorderbyid) a 这时发现结果没有按id排序,需要将100 percent 改成 99.999 percent 或10000000(尽量大) select*from(selecttop99.999percent*fromtableorderbyid) a 或 select*from(selecttop1000000*fromtabl...
SELECT col_name FROM tab_name ORDER BY col_name; --union 返回的结果去除重复值 SELECT col_name FROM tab_name UNION ALL SELECT col_name FROM tab_name ORDER BY col_name; --union all 返回的结果保留了重复值 1. 2. 3. 4. 5. 6. 7. 8. 9. 五、附加例题 e.g1. Products表含有字段prod...
1SELECTTOP1LastNameFROMPerson.Person2ORDERBYLastName3GO 在执行计划里,SQL Server从哪个索引读取行并不重要——Sort(Top N Sort)的运算符在执行计划里会物理预排序行,并从它返回第N行——很简单,是不是? 小结 在SQL(编程语言本身)里ORDER BY子句并不是一个最简单的概念。如你在这篇文章里所学的,ORDER BY...
-- Syntax for SQL Server and Azure SQL DatabaseORDERBYorder_by_expression[COLLATEcollation_name] [ASC|DESC] [ ,...n ] [<offset_fetch>]<offset_fetch>::={OFFSET{integer_constant|offset_row_count_expression} {ROW|ROWS} [FETCH{FIRST|NEXT} {integer_constant|fetch_row_count_expression} ...
ORDER BY子句用于对SQL查询结果进行排序。在将整数参数传递到SQL Server中的ORDER BY子句时,可以使用以下步骤: 首先,确保已连接到SQL Server数据库,并选择要查询的表。 构建SQL查询语句,包括ORDER BY子句。ORDER BY子句应该跟在FROM子句之后和WHERE子句之前。 在ORDER BY子句中指定要排序的列。这些列可以...
sql server查询(SELECT ,where,distinct,like 查询,in,is null,group by 和having,order by,as),基本查询:实例表1示例表2--部门表34createtabledept(56deptnointprimarykey,--部门编号78dnamenvarchar(30),--部门名910locnvarchar(30)--地址1112);1314...
这意味着使用 uniqueidentifier 键建立的索引可能会比使用 int 键实现的索引相对慢一些。
sql server查询(SELECT ,where,distinct,like 查询,in,is null,group by 和having,order by,as) 2019-12-04 21:52 −基本查询: 实例表 1 示例表 2 --部门表 3 4 create table dept( 5 6 deptno int primary key,--部门编号 7 8 dname nvarchar(30),--部门名 9 10 loc nvarchar(30)--地址 ....
sql server查询(SELECT ,where,distinct,like 查询,in,is null,group by 和having,order by,as) 2019-12-04 21:52 −基本查询: 实例表 1 示例表 2 --部门表 3 4 create table dept( 5 6 deptno int primary key,--部门编号 7 8 dname nvarchar(30),--部门名 9 10 loc nvarchar(30)--地址 ....
この記事では、Sql Server Migration Assistant (SSMA) for Oracle が Oracle in ORDER BY 句を含むROWNUMステートメントを変換できない理由について説明します。 背景 Oracle ROWNUM 擬似列は、テーブルから行が選択された順序を示す数値を返します。 選択した最初の1行には a ROWNUM があり、2 ...